2. Choosing The Right Wood

Choosing The Right Wood

Selecting the right wood for your cheddar is essential for both Its functionality and aesthetic appeal. Hardwoods such As maple, walnut, or cherry are popular choices due to their durability and attractive grain patterns. These woods provide a solid base For arranging and serving cheeses while adding an elegant touch To the presentation.

3. Essential Tools And Materials

To craft a cheese board from wood, You will need basic woodworking tools such as a saw, sandpaper, wood glue, clamps, and A food-safe finish such as mineral oil or beeswax. Additionally, having access to various sized bowls or templates for creating spaces for accompaniments Can greatly enhance the design aspect of your cheese plank.

5. Preparing The Wood

Preparing The Wood

Before assembling your swiss board, It is crucial to prepare the wood properly. This involves cutting The wood to The desired size and shape, followed by sanding all surfaces To achieve A smooth and splinter-free finish. Applying A food-safe finish such as mineral oil or beeswax not only enhances the wood’s natural beauty but also creates a protective barrier For serving food.

10. Maintenance And Care

Proper maintenance Is essential for preserving the integrity of your wooden cheese board. Regularly clean It with a gentle dish soap And warm water, avoiding prolonged exposure to moisture. After cleaning, allow the board to air dry thoroughly before storing it In a cool, dry place.

11. Preserving The Wood

Preserving The Wood

To maintain the beauty and longevity of your wooden cheddar board, periodic conditioning is recommended. Apply a thin layer of food-grade mineral oil or beeswax using a soft cloth or brush, allowing it to penetrate the wood for several hours or overnight before wiping off any excess. This simple yet crucial step helps replenish the wood’s natural oils and protects it against drying out or cracking over time.

12. Cleaning And Storage

After the delightful cheese experience, promptly clean the cheese board by wiping it with a damp cloth and mild detergent. Avoid soaking or exposing the wood to excessive moisture to prevent warping or cracking. Once dry, store the cheese plank in a cool, well-ventilated area to maintain its quality.
